Top Formal Synonyms for Special Thanks
Below, I’ve curated a comprehensive list of elegant alternatives for “special thanks.” I’ve divided these into categories for different contexts and audiences, with clear examples to help you use them effortlessly.
1. Gratitude in Professional Correspondence
| Phrase | Usage Context | Example Sentence |
|---|---|---|
| Express my sincere appreciation | Formal emails, letters | "I wish to express my sincere appreciation for your support during the project." |
| Extend my deepest thanks | Award ceremonies, high-stakes situations | "I would like to extend my deepest thanks for your invaluable contribution." |
| Accept my heartfelt thanks | Personal but formal acknowledgments | "Please accept my heartfelt thanks for your continuous assistance." |
| My profound gratitude | When emphasis is needed | "My profound gratitude for your exceptional service is truly appreciated." |
| With utmost thanks | Formal letters and speeches | "With utmost thanks, I acknowledge your dedication." |
2. Expressing Appreciation for Support or Assistance
| Phrase | Usage Context | Example Sentence |
|---|---|---|
| Thank you graciously | When you want to sound more refined | "Thank you graciously for your helpful advice." |
| I am truly grateful | When emphasizing authenticity | "I am truly grateful for your unwavering support." |
| With my deepest appreciation | For sincere gratitude | "With my deepest appreciation, I thank you for your hard work." |
| Acknowledging with gratitude | For formal notices | "We are acknowledging your efforts with gratitude." |
| Heartfelt thanks for your kindness | When praising personal qualities | "Heartfelt thanks for your kindness and generosity." |
3. Recognition in Formal Speeches and Certificates
| Phrase | Usage Context | Example Sentence |
|---|---|---|
| In appreciation of your efforts | Awards, recognitions | "This certificate is awarded in appreciation of your efforts." |
| In recognition of your outstanding service | Honoring contributions | "In recognition of your outstanding service, we present this award." |
| With sincere acknowledgment | Formal acknowledgments | "With sincere acknowledgment of your dedication." |
| Our formal thanks | Corporate statements | "Our formal thanks extend to everyone involved." |
| Thank you for your exemplary commitment | Inspirational contexts | "Thank you for your exemplary commitment." |
4. Expressing Gratitude in Academic and Research Settings
| Phrase | Usage Context | Example Sentence |
|---|---|---|
| Appreciate your valuable insights | Academic discussions | "I appreciate your valuable insights during the seminar." |
| My sincere gratitude for your scholarly assistance | Research collaborations | "My sincere gratitude for your scholarly assistance." |
| Express my heartfelt appreciation for your guidance | Mentorship | "I want to express my heartfelt appreciation for your guidance." |
| Thank you for your scholarly support | Academic acknowledgments | "Thank you for your scholarly support and feedback." |

Tips for Success in Using Formal Thanks
- Match the tone of your message to the occasion.
- Be specific: mention what you are thankful for.
- Maintain sincerity: genuine appreciation always resonates.
- Use appropriate titles: Mr., Dr., Professor, etc., where relevant.
- Vary your expressions to avoid repetition.
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them
| Mistake | How to Fix |
|---|---|
| Overusing the same phrase | Mix synonyms for variety, use different expressions for different contexts. |
| Being too vague | Specify what exactly you're thanking for. |
| Using informal phrases in formal settings | Stick to professional, polished language. |
| Lack of personalization | Include names or specific deeds for sincerity. |
